Job Summary
Gather patient information and vital signs, administer medications and vaccines, perform diagnostic screenings, and collect specimens for testing. Conduct in-office clinical procedures, review EMR orders, and relay lab results to patients via phone or portal. Provide patient and family education, document chart entries accurately, and respond to urgent acute situations based on prioritization skills. Coordinate care with in-house specialties, community resources, and hospital teams while adhering to industry guidelines and HIPAA policies. Maintain strict confidentiality and complete mandatory certifications. Requires an active Maine RN license, BLS within six weeks, and proficiency in EMR systems.
